ویژگی تصویر

تابع EVEN در اکسل — معرفی و کاربردها

  /  اکسل   /  تابع EVEN در اکسل
بنر تبلیغاتی الف

تابع EVEN در اکسل برای گرد کردن اعداد تا نزدیک‌ترین عدد زوج استفاده می‌شود. این تابع عدد ورودی را به سمت عدد زوج “بزرگ‌تر از مقدار مطلق” یا به عبارت دیگر به سمت دور از صفر گرد می‌کند. کاربردهای رایج شامل آماده‌سازی داده‌ها برای گزارش‌دهی، دسته‌بندی مقادیر عددی، محاسبات بسته‌بندی و تولید شناسه‌های زوج است.

قواعد پایه‌ای تابع

  • فرمول: =EVEN(number)
  • اگر عدد ورودی مثبت باشد، تابع عدد را به سمت بالا و تا نزدیک‌ترین عدد زوج گرد می‌کند (مثلاً 3 → 4، 4.1 → 6).
  • اگر عدد ورودی منفی باشد، تابع عدد را به سمت پایین (منفی‌تر) و تا نزدیک‌ترین عدد زوج گرد می‌کند (مثلاً -3 → -4، -2.1 → -4).
  • عدد صفر به صفر تبدیل می‌شود.

مثال‌های ساده

ورودیفرمولخروجی
3.2=EVEN(3.2)4
4=EVEN(4)4
-3.2=EVEN(-3.2)-4
0=EVEN(0)0

نمونه‌های فرمولی در کد

=EVEN(A1)

این فرمول مقدار سلول A1 را گرفته و آن را به نزدیک‌ترین عدد زوج (به سمت دور از صفر) گرد می‌کند. اگر A1 شامل عددی مانند 7.3 باشد خروجی 8 خواهد بود، و اگر A1 = -1.5 خروجی -2 خواهد بود.

=IF(A1>0,EVEN(A1),A1)

در اینجا ابتدا بررسی می‌شود که آیا مقدار در A1 مثبت است یا خیر. اگر مثبت باشد، آن را با EVEN گرد می‌کنیم؛ در غیر این صورت مقدار اصلی را بازمی‌گردانیم. این الگو زمانی مفید است که بخواهید فقط مقادیر مثبت را به عدد زوج تبدیل کنید و مقادیر منفی یا صفر را دست نخورده نگه دارید.

=SUM(EVEN(A1:A5))

در اکسل‌های جدید (Office 365/Excel 2021 به بعد) این فرمول به صورت پویا آرایه مقادیر EVEN(A1:A5) را ایجاد کرده و مجموع آن را برمی‌گرداند. در نسخه‌های قدیمی‌تر اکسل لازم است فرمول را به عنوان یک فرمول آرایه‌ای با Ctrl+Shift+Enter وارد کنید تا درست کار کند؛ در غیر این صورت خروجی ممکن است خطا یا مقدار غیرمنتظره بدهد.

موارد کاربردی و نکات پیشرفته

  • دسته‌بندی یا binning: برای گروه‌بندی مقادیر به بازه‌هایی که انتهای آن‌ها زوج است مناسب است؛ مثلاً تعیین حداقل تعدادی که باید برای بسته‌بندی تهیه شود تا تعداد نهایی زوج باشد.
  • ایجاد شناسه یا شماره‌های زوج: وقتی فرمت سیستم یا استانداردی نیاز به اعداد زوج دارد، می‌توان با EVEN مقادیر را به سرعت اصلاح کرد.
  • همکاری با توابع شرطی: ترکیب EVEN با IF یا CHOOSE برای اعمال منطق پیچیده‌تر روی داده‌ها مفید است.
  • مقایسه با توابع دیگر: برخلاف CEILING یا ROUND، EVEN همیشه به عدد زوج نزدیک می‌شود و جهت گرد کردن آن «به سمت دور از صفر» است؛ اگر بخواهید به نزدیک‌ترین عدد زوج با قاعده متفاوت (مثلاً به سمت صفر یا بر اساس مضرب معین) نیاز دارید از توابع CEILING, FLOOR یا MROUND استفاده کنید.

خطاها و محدودیت‌ها

  • #VALUE! — وقتی آرگومان عددی نباشد (مثل متن غیرقابل تبدیل به عدد).
  • در نسخه‌های قدیمی اکسل، استفاده از EVEN روی آرایه‌ها نیازمند فرمول‌های آرایه‌ای (Ctrl+Shift+Enter) است؛ در غیر این صورت باید از روش‌هایی مانند SUMPRODUCT یا helper column استفاده کنید.
  • تابع EVEN فقط عدد صحیح زوج تولید می‌کند؛ اگر به اعداد اعشاری زوج (مثلاً با گام 2.0) نیاز دارید باید از توابع سفارشی یا ترکیب با ضرب و تقسیم استفاده کنید.

مثال ترکیبی: محاسبه مجموع بسته‌های زوج

فرض کنید در ستون A تعداد سفارش‌ها نوشته شده و شما می‌خواهید بدانید برای هر سفارش چه تعداد بستهٔ زوج لازم است (هر بسته حداکثر 1 واحد، اما تعداد بسته باید زوج باشد). در ستون B می‌توانید از EVEN برای محاسبه تعداد بستهٔ واقعی استفاده کنید و در نهایت مجموع بسته‌ها را محاسبه کنید.

=EVEN(A2)

این فرمول تعداد مورد نیاز برای یک ردیف را به عدد زوج گرد می‌کند. شما می‌توانید این فرمول را رو به پایین کپی کنید و سپس با =SUM(B2:B100) مجموع بسته‌ها را بدست آورید.

مقایسه با تابع ODD و نکات کاربردی

  • ODD برعکس EVEN عمل کرده و عدد را تا نزدیک‌ترین عدد فرد گرد می‌کند. بنابراین اگر نیاز به زوج دارید EVEN و اگر نیاز به فرد دارید ODD مناسب است.
  • در ترکیب با توابع گزارش‌گیری، استفاده از EVEN می‌تواند کمک کند تا قالب‌بندی چاپ یا آرایش جدولی به صورت منظم و زوج-فرد دیده شود.

خلاصه و توصیه‌های عملی

تابع EVEN ابزار ساده و مفیدی برای تبدیل سریع اعداد به زوج‌ها است. نکته کلیدی در کاربرد این تابع فهم جهت گرد کردن (همیشه دور از صفر) و سازگاری با نسخه اکسل مورد استفاده است. در پروژه‌های تحلیلی، هنگام استفاده از آرایه‌ها دقت کنید که نسخه اکسل شما از dynamic arrays پشتیبانی می‌کند یا باید از فرمول‌های آرایه‌ای (Ctrl+Shift+Enter) یا ستون‌های کمکی استفاده نمایید.

با ترکیب EVEN با توابع شرطی و تجمیعی می‌توانید سناریوهای پیچیده‌تری مانند دسته‌بندی، محاسبه هزینه بسته‌بندی، یا تولید شناسه‌های استاندارد را به‌سادگی پیاده‌سازی کنید.

آیا این مطلب برای شما مفید بود ؟

خیر
بله
موضوعات شما در انجمن: